Alert: bloomgate-false-negative-spike. The Ferroway bloom filter fronting the Cobblestone KV store is reporting a false-negative rate above 0.1%, which should be impossible by design and usually means the filter and store have diverged after a failed rebuild. Reads are falling through to disk; latency p99 is climbing. Do not restart the filter pods before capturing a snapshot of the bitset. Rebuild and verification steps are on the internal page below.

runbook for taduf-kawef: https://confluence.qorvelsys.internal/projects/display/display/pages

## Deployment

Glimmerfill, the nightly backfill scheduler maintained by the Harrowgate platform team, must be deployed only from signed release artifacts. The service runs under a dedicated non-privileged account, and all outbound connections are restricted to the Pellworth data tier. Before initiating the rollout, verify that secrets are sourced from the vault rather than inline. The reviewer should confirm the following configuration values:

config for bahop-fajep:
DRUATH_PIN=4501
DRUATH_TENANT=briwyn
DRUATH_METRICS_HOST=metrics.druath.brasksoft.test
DRUATH_SEAL=seal_7d2e069d
DRUATH_STANDBY_TEAM=olieth

Runbook: log sampling for chirpd

The chirpd service emits roughly 40k lines/min at baseline, so we sample INFO at 1:100 and keep WARN/ERROR unsampled. Security-relevant events (auth failures, token refresh anomalies) bypass sampling entirely via the audit sink. If you need full-fidelity logs for an investigation, flip the sampling flag in the Ferrow config map and allow ten minutes for rollout; revert within 24 hours to avoid storage alerts. Verify your change against the active build token below.

trace token, fafog-kageg: htk4_98e6

Ticket TL-442: The staging instance of Chronoplan, our school timetable solver, was deployed with the production solver queue credentials. This means staging runs can enqueue jobs against live district schedules at Hollowbrook Academy. We need to rotate the affected credential and point staging at its own queue. For the security review, note that the fix requires updating the staging .env with the following line:

vault entry, tagug-hahip: ARCHIVE_KEY3=e34